Washington drivers: did you know that the left lane of the highway is only for passing? (Not applicable to HOV lanes).

Left lane campers can be fined $136.

Effective Today 7/23/2017

A person who uses a personal electronic device while driving a motor vehicle on a public highway is guilty of a traffic infraction and must pay a fine as provided in RCW 46.63.110(3).

"Use" or "uses" means: (i) Holding a personal electronic device in either hand or both hands; (ii) Using your hand or finger to compose, send, read, view, access, browse, transmit, save, or retrieve email, text messages, instant messages, photographs, or other electronic data; however, this does not preclude the minimal use of a finger to activate, deactivate, or initiate a function of the device; (iii) Watching video on a personal electronic device.
